基于单反射椭圆模型的多径信道仿真研究

摘    要:无线通信信道的空间特性十分复杂,通信信道的精细仿真对无线通信网络的设计和开发有着重要的作用.研究了基于单反射椭圆模型的多径信道模型原理,根据随机变量函数的变换原理,推导了由均匀分布的随机变量样本得到TOA、DOA样本的仿真原理.就仿真结果和理想理论进行了对比,效果良好,说明这一仿真原理正确可靠.

关 键 词:单反射椭圆模型  多径信道模型  蒙特卡洛仿真  无线通信信道  随机变量函数

Multipath channel simulative research based on GBSBEM

Abstract:The spatial characteristic of wireless communication channel is very complex.The fine simulation of the channel is helpful to design and develop wireless communication net. In this paper, the principle of geometrically based single bounce elliptical model (GBSBEM) was researched. On the basis of stochastic variable function transform theory we deduced the TOA and DOA simulation principle from a uniform distribution stochastic variable. The results of simulation indicate that this proposed principle is valid and reliable.
Keywords:GBSBEM  multipath channel model  Monte Carlo simulation
